Title
Identification of modal parameters of machine tools during cutting by operational modal analysis

Abstract
The dynamic behaviour of machine tools differs between standstill and process state. Operational modal analysis (OMA) makes possible to identify modal parameter under process conditions. In this paper, it is shown, how far the assumption of a time-invariant behaviour as well as abroad band excitation can be fulfilled by exciting the machine with a cutting process. After describing the dynamic behaviour in the work space to determine a time-invariant tool path, a broadband excitation is generated by changing cutting parameters during milling. The modal parameters are identified by different OMA methods and compared to results of the experimental modal analysis.
